Sunshine Hotel in an excellent location, as already mentioned. I`ve not stayed there, the new wing looks good from the outside. As well as the nearby Sailor bar for decent value food, you have plenty of other choices nearby. One that is also quite good for the money is " Seaside Restaurant ", which is in a little cut through between soi 7 & soi 8, next to " Globetrotter Hotel and Restaurant " About 2 minutes walk from where you will be staying. 24 hour restaurant also within 2 minutes walk, turn out of your hotel on to soi 8, walking away from the Beach and you will see 2 restaurants on the other side of what is known as 2nd Road. The one on the left is open 24 hours, mix of Thai and Western type food. Plenty of nearby food choices, as already mentioned. Thanks, I`ll send you a PM or post here nearer the time to arrange a meet up. There is a " Drinking Street " in north Pattaya. To get there from where you will be staying, exit your hotel, walk up soi 8 away from the beach, when you get to 2nd Road( 20 seconds from your hotel) catch a bahtbus. It should go straight across the next set of traffic lights, if it turns left( a very few do ) you need to jump off and start again. Or you can walk across the set of lights and catch one there( 2 minutes walk if that from your hotel) After about 5 minutes( on bahtbus) you should notice on your right, the " Drinking Street " sign, it is a short way after " Big C" shopping centre, also on your right, i.e just keep looking to your right. Very near " JJ Market " massive signage for that. 2nd Road is one way, if before you see Drinking Street, the bahtbus turns left( again unlikely) get off. If you get to a roundabout, you`ve gone too far, get off, walk against the traffic and in less than 5 minutes you will be at Drinking Street I hope that is not too confusing, in reality it is very easy, just hard to describe. or you can get a motorbike taxi, maybe 30 baht at a guess Drinking Street has approx 20 bars or so, a few places for food and as you have said quite a few pool tables. Some like it, others don`t. I`ve been a few times, found it to be OK, although haven`t been for a while. There`s a handful of other bars within easy walking distance. 5 minutes on bahtbus from your hotel, worth taking a look if the sound of it appeals. |
